**Q: Why do converted totals sometimes differ by a cent in Ledgerloom?**

Ledgerloom converts currencies using six-decimal intermediate precision, then rounds half-even at display time. Summing rounded line items can therefore differ from rounding the summed total. This is expected; reconciliation jobs account for it nightly. If a discrepancy exceeds one cent per hundred items, report it to the address below.

escalation mailbox, hadug-bajog: sormir@norvalabs.internal

Hey — handover notes before I'm out next week. You'll own releases for Splitwheel, our A/B experiment assignment service. Deploys go out Tuesdays; the assignment hash logic is frozen mid-experiment, so never ship config changes on a Friday. Runbook covers rollbacks, and Mirela can answer anything about the bucketing math. You'll need push access to the release remote, so I've set you up — the deploy key is below.

signing key of bagap-yawep = bky13_TbfT6ZMUoGJo2

**Management Meeting Minutes — Board Copy**

Attendees: Pria Ostlund, Ferdin Marsh, Olya Trenn. Main topic was the Wexbury depot lease. The landlord wants a 14% increase; Ferdin thinks we can hold them to 6% given the vacancy rates nearby. Olya raised the option of relocating to the Carrow Flats site, but moving costs would eat two years of savings. We agreed to counter at 5% and revisit in three weeks. One sensitive point came up at the end.

management briefing: Project Ulavan slips by two quarters because of the staffing delay.

Welcome to Snapveil on-call. Quick context for your first review queue: the EXIF scrubber strips location, device, and timestamp tags on upload, before anything hits storage. Watch for PRs that bypass the scrub path or add new upload endpoints — both need the scrub middleware. Test fixtures with known-dirty images live in the metadata suite. The scrub pipeline spec and review checklist are documented here.

wiki page, tahaf-tajog: https://jira.ordindyn.corp/pipeline